Today is the last day to shop the FabFitFun Fall 2019 Edit Sale! (This is basically like Add-Ons, except these items aren't shipping with your FabFitFun Box.)

FYI – FabFitFun transitioned to a new Warehouse Management System in the past few months and there have been some issues in shipping since then. Some readers have reported not receiving their Summer Box or Summer Edit sale items yet. We’ll update when we have more information, but please keep in mind that shipping may be delayed with FabFitFun orders currently.

Here’s everything you need to know about the sale:

  • The sale will feature beauty, fashion, fitness, wellness, and lifestyle items at 30% to 70% off.
  • Don’t forget that Edits are just like Add-Ons and you’ll be auto-billed for everything at the end of the sale.
  • Closes to ALL members on Monday, Sept. 30 at 11:59 p.m. PT.
  • No checkout required. All products in your cart will be automatically billed on Tuesday, Oct. 1.
  • Shipping is FREE for any orders over $25 within the contiguous U.S.
